## Runbook: Dark Mode (Ledgerline Admin)

Dark-mode flags are served by the theming service, not client storage. Flag reads are authenticated; no PII involved. Review scope: theme endpoint authz and flag cache TTL. To query the theming service directly during review, authenticate with the key below.

API key for tagug-tajef: vxb4-R1fo

Visitors are not permitted to remove keys from the pool-car cabinet in the Dunmarsh Building lobby under any circumstances. Night-shift staff releasing a vehicle must record the registration, time, and requester in the logbook before opening the cabinet, and confirm the key's return at shift end. To unlock the cabinet, enter the code shown below.

staff pass of kawip-hawef = bdg-QLP-2

## Onboarding: Slotwise Optimizer

Slotwise generates optimized pick lists for Ferrobin's distribution floors. Contractors: scope is the routing engine only — do not modify inventory adapters or the congestion heuristics without sign-off. Dev environment runs against synthetic warehouse layouts; never point local builds at production feeds. Code review is mandatory for every change, no exceptions. Build steps, test data, and access policies are documented on the internal page.

dashboard of bafof-hafog = https://confluence.lumiclabs.internal/display/browse/display/6a09a20a